Job Description
We are seeking anAccounts Payable Clerkto join our client in Dartmouth.
This contract role is perfect for a proactive accounting professional who can hit the ground running and provide hands-on support.
Key Responsibilities for the Job:
- Code enter and process vendor invoices accurately and in accordance with internal controls
- Prepare and process payment runs
- Monitor and reconcile bank and credit card transactions
- Maintain journals ledgers and supporting financial documentation
- Perform bank reconciliations and prepare journal entries
- Answer phone calls and provide general administrative support as needed
- Perform other duties as assigned
Experience & Attributes for Success:
- Minimum 1 - 3 years of experience in a similar accounts payable focused or versatile accounting role
- Post-secondary education in Accounting or a related field
- Strong proficiency in Microsoft Excel
- Highly organized with strong attention to detail
- Ability to work independently and manage competing priorities
- Comfortable working under pressure and meeting deadlines
- Strong problem-solving skills and adaptability
- Professional communication skills and willingness to support a collaborative team environment
